ITEM SUMMARY:

 

                     Section 394.001 of the Texas Local Government Code allows Housing Finance Corporations to partner with private developers in the creation of affordable or mixed-income developments

                     Housing Finance Corporations receive financial benefit from the partnership from the project by sharing in the project cash flow and development fee

                     Project proceeds may be used to meet City of McKinney affordable housing needs

 

BACKGROUND INFORMATION:

 

                     In October 2018, the City Council approved a Request for Qualifications (RFQ) for the process to select a private developer to partner in developing an affordable or mixed-income development.

                     The resulting project, The Independence by NRP Holdings, LLC will celebrate a grand opening in June of 2022.

                     Based on the success of the first partnership and the Council priority to further workforce and affordable housing, a second RFQ for more projects has been prepared.

                     The McKinney Housing Finance Corporation (MHFC) reviewed and recommended approval of the attached RFQ at their April meeting.

                     This RFQ differs from the first RFQ in two ways:

o                     It permits consideration for Public Facilities Corporations (PFC’s).

o                     It is an open RFQ, with no submittal deadline or limit on the number projects that can be considered.

o                     

FINANCIAL SUMMARY:

 

                     The McKinney Housing Finance Corporation will recognize financial gain from the transaction as a percentage of the developer fee and cash flow.  These amounts will be negotiated by McKinney Housing Finance Corporation financial counsel
